Even par round 2 to finish 4 off the cut of -1. Super solid week for an amateur. Lots to build on and I was impressed by his game, golf IQ and attitude. He got the right amount of pissed off by bogies but didn’t let it impact the next hole. Likewise had the right amount of aggression but didn’t play recklessly - lots of middle of the green shots and playing front edges plus a few yards to let the ball release.

We got a favorable wind on the 3rd hole and he was able to drive the 395y par 4 (~330 “as the crow flies”) and had 20 feet for eagle (missed but nice to tap in a birdie). Nothing worse than bogie and made 5 birdies over two rounds.

Super fun for my second time caddying in this event - I felt more comfortable and knew where to be and not be etc. would recommend anyone who lives near a KF event look into going or trying to volunteer or caddie or something - great way to get up close to some really high level golf with almost no crowds

Heck seems to have what it takes to be a force for many years to come.

speaking of being a force: Mickey Wright has 82 LPGA wins (2nd all time) and 13 major wins (2nd all time), and is the only LPGA player to hold all four major titles at the same time.
she 'retired' at age 34 due to foot problems. who knows what her totals would have been if she could have played ten more years.
